Skip to content

Conversation

@dependabot-preview
Copy link

Bumps mongoose from 5.1.6 to 5.7.1.

Changelog

Sourced from mongoose's changelog.

5.7.1 / 2019-09-13

  • fix(query): fix TypeError when calling findOneAndUpdate() with runValidators #8151 fernandolguevara
  • fix(document): throw strict mode error if setting an immutable path with strict mode: false #8149
  • fix(mongoose): support passing options object to Mongoose constructor #8144
  • fix(model): make syncIndexes() handle changes in index key order #8135
  • fix(error): export StrictModeError as a static property of MongooseError #8148 ouyuran
  • docs(connection+mongoose): add useUnifiedTopology option to connect() and openUri() docs #8146

5.7.0 / 2019-09-09

  • feat(document+query): support conditionally immutable schema paths #8001
  • perf(documentarray): refactor to use ES6 classes instead of mixins, ~30% speedup #7895
  • feat: use MongoDB driver 3.3.x for MongoDB 4.2 support #8083 #8078
  • feat(schema+query): add pre('validate') and post('validate') hooks for update validation #7984
  • fix(timestamps): ensure updatedAt gets incremented consistently using update with and without $set #4768
  • feat(query): add Query#get() to make writing custom setters that handle both queries and documents easier #7312
  • feat(document): run setters on defaults #8012
  • feat(document): add aliases: false option to Document#toObject() #7548
  • feat(timestamps): support skipping updatedAt and createdAt for individual save() and update() #3934
  • docs: fix index creation link in guide #8138 joebowbeer

5.6.13 / 2019-09-04

  • fix(parallel): fix parallelLimit when fns is empty #8130 #8128 sibelius
  • fix(document): ensure nested mixed validator gets called exactly once #8117
  • fix(populate): handle justOne = undefined #8125 taxilian

5.6.12 / 2019-09-03

  • fix(schema): handle required validator correctly with clone() #8111
  • fix(schema): copy schematype getters and setters when cloning #8124 StphnDamon
  • fix(discriminator): avoid unnecessarily cloning schema to avoid leaking memory on repeated discriminator() calls #2874
  • docs(schematypes): clarify when Mongoose uses toString() to convert an object to a string #8112 TheTrueRandom
  • docs(plugins): fix out of date link to npm docs #8100
  • docs(deprecations): fix typo #8109 jgcmarins
  • refactor(model): remove dependency on async.parallelLimit() for insertMany() #8073

5.6.11 / 2019-08-25

  • fix(model): allow passing options to exists() #8075
  • fix(document): make validateUpdatedOnly option handle pre-existing errors #8091
  • fix: throw readable error if middleware callback isnt a function #8087
  • fix: don't throw error if calling find() on a nested array #8089
  • docs(middleware): clarify that you must add middleware before compiling your model #5087
  • docs(query): add missing options to setOptions() #8099

5.6.10 / 2019-08-20

  • fix(schema): fix require() path to work around yet another bug in Jest #8053
... (truncated)
Commits
  • 32c4e3c chore: release 5.7.1
  • 0aec7ad fix(document): fix test failures from fix for #8149
  • b4d0303 Merge branch 'master' of github.com:Automattic/mongoose
  • 8d86802 fix(document): throw strict mode error if setting an immutable path with stri...
  • 74f558c test(document): repro #8149
  • 3f9c9b8 Merge pull request #8151 from fernandolguevara/patch-2
  • 6e86500 fix(model): make syncIndexes() handle changes in index key order
  • ce9d8d0 test(model): repro #8135
  • b8cf292 chore: remove paperleaf and papersowl as sponsors
  • 691aabb fix(mongoose): support passing options object to Mongoose constructor
  • Additional commits viewable in compare view

Dependabot compatibility score

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ot merge will merge this PR after your CI passes on it
  • @dependabot squash and merge will squash and merge this PR after your CI passes on it
  • @dependabot cancel merge will cancel a previously requested merge and block automerging
  • @dependabot reopen will reopen this PR if it is closed
  • @dependabot close will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ually
  • @dependabot ignore this major version will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this minor version will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)
  • @dependabot ignore this dependency will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
  • @dependabot use these labels will set the current labels as the default for future PRs for this repo and language
  • @dependabot use these reviewers will set the current reviewers as the default for future PRs for this repo and language
  • @dependabot use these assignees will set the current assignees as the default for future PRs for this repo and language
  • @dependabot use this milestone will set the current milestone as the default for future PRs for this repo and language
  • @dependabot badge me will comment on this PR with code to add a "Dependabot enabled" badge to your readme

Additionally, you can set the following in your Dependabot dashboard:

  • Update frequency (including time of day and day of week)
  • Pull request limits (per update run and/or open at any time)
  • Out-of-range updates (receive only lockfile updates, if desired)
  • Security updates (receive only security updates, if desired)

Finally, you can contact us by mentioning @dependabot.

Bumps [mongoose](https://github.com/Automattic/mongoose) from 5.1.6 to 5.7.1.
- [Release notes](https://github.com/Automattic/mongoose/releases)
- [Changelog](https://github.com/Automattic/mongoose/blob/master/History.md)
- [Commits](Automattic/mongoose@5.1.6...5.7.1)

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
@dependabot-preview dependabot-preview bot added the dependencies Pull requests that update a dependency file label Sep 16, 2019
@dependabot-preview
Copy link
Author

Superseded by #46.

@dependabot-preview dependabot-preview bot deleted the dependabot/npm_and_yarn/mongoose-5.7.1 branch September 30, 2019 19:49
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Pull requests that update a dependency file

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ant